Nantucket Self-Guided Audio Walking Tour: Beyond the Cobblestones
Explore historic downtown Nantucket on a self-guided audio walking tour. Follow a roughly 2-mile route as stories and directions play automatically along the way.
Hear how Nantucket rose to prominence as a whaling port, how Quaker families shaped the island, and how its economy and architecture evolved after the whaling era. See landmarks including the Nantucket Atheneum, Straight Wharf, Hadwen House, Greater Light, and Jared Coffin House.

Plymouth Pilgrim Historic Self Guided GPS Audio Walking Tour
The tour will take you from the decks of the Mayflower Two, a faithful replica of the Pilgrims’ ship, and end at the historic Jabez Howland House, the last standing home in Plymouth where Pilgrims actually lived. Along the way you'll walk for an hour and about a mile as you explore Plymouth rock, statues, houses, gardens, churches and sites linked to the Pilgrims. Go at your own pace, anytime. Boston 101 Best Historical Walking Tour
Step back in time to where America began.
Boston is more than just a fun city; it is the cradle of American liberty. From the legendary ride of Paul Revere to the tension of the Boston Massacre, our Boston 101 Essential Historical Walking Tour brings the 17th and 18th centuries to life.
We show you pictures and paintings of Boston's history so you can visualize the past. Led by certified historians, this 90-minute guided experience is the perfect introduction for first-time visitors and history buffs alike.
You'll see Boston Common, Park Street Church, Granary Burying Grounds, King's Chapel, Boston Massacre site, old jail location, Faneuil Hall that are all on the freedom trail. You will hear about the Battle of Bunker Hill, the siege of Boston and how Henry Knox forced the British out of Boston.
